Why a Landlord Gas Safety Certificate is a Legal Requirement
A landlord gas safety certificate is a legal requirement for UK landlords. It shows that all of your home appliances have been tested and are safe to utilize. It also identifies any hazardous home appliances that need to be repaired.
It's a great concept to get your gas safety checks done by a Gas Safe engineer. They'll check each home appliance and tape-record the results in a Gas Safety Record.
Gas safety check
If you own a property that you rent, it is necessary to make sure that all of the gas devices are safe for your tenants. This can be done by performing a landlord gas safety check every year. This is a legal requirement, and will make sure that your renters are safe from any defective or dangerous gas devices. A gas safety check will include an evaluation of all gas home appliances, consisting of boilers, fires and cookers. This will also include the pipework that provides these appliances with gas. If any of the appliances or pipework are faulty, it is likely that they will need to be replaced, which will increase the expense of the evaluation.
Landlords are required by law to have all gas home appliances and flues checked yearly by a Gas Safe Registered engineer. The outcomes of this yearly check will be tape-recorded on a certificate, referred to as a CP12 certificate Landlords need to offer a copy of the CP12 certificate to their renters within 28 days of the check occurring or before they let brand-new renters move in. This is to help in reducing the danger of carbon monoxide poisoning, which can be extremely harmful if not identified early on.
The CP12 certificate will include detailed info on all of the devices and flues that have actually been inspected. It will consist of the date of the check, the engineer's details and the address of the residential or commercial property. It will also contain a complete list of the home appliances and flues that have passed or failed. The engineer will likewise record any problems that have actually been identified and the work that has actually been carried out to remedy them.
A CP12 certificate is a legally binding file that needs to be provided to renters in England, Scotland and Wales. The landlord must show a copy of the CP12 certificate in a prominent position in the residential or commercial property, which should be available to renters at all times. If a landlord does not have a valid CP12 certificate, they might be fined. It is necessary to get your CP12 certificates renewed routinely, as this will keep you within the law and ensure that your devices are safe for your tenants.
Gas safety certificate.
A gas safety certificate, also known as a CP12, is a main document provided by a Gas Safe registered engineer to validate that the gas devices, pipe work and flues in your rental property are safe to utilize. It is a legal requirement for landlords to have their residential or commercial properties inspected and licensed each year. This is to ensure the health and well-being of your renters. If you have not had a gas inspection in the last 12 months, you might be at danger of fines and other charges.
A Gas Safe engineer will visit your home to perform the evaluation and issue a certificate once it has actually been completed. This will consist of examining the gas devices that you own, consisting of fireplaces, in addition to a test of the meter and making sure all gas pipework is safely fitted. They will check that all gas devices are changed off, unplugged and removed if they are not being utilized. They will likewise test the operation of all flues and check that they are physically steady and have the right stability brackets or chains attached if applicable.
The cost of a gas safety check will vary depending on the number of devices, meter and flues that need to be tested. It is possible to save cash by "lumping" together services, such as combining the gas safety inspection with a yearly boiler service, or utilizing a letting representative that consists of the expense of a gas check in their management charge. The area of your home will also affect the cost, with rates in London typically greater than in other places.
Landlords are legally required to provide a copy of their gas safety record to existing occupants within 28 days of the conclusion of the inspection, or to new occupants upon start of the occupancy. It is likewise a great idea to display a copy of the record in a popular place in your residential or commercial property.
Although the Gas Safety Certificate is not a requirement for homeowners, it is extremely advised. A routine evaluation by a Gas Safe-registered engineer can help minimize the risks of carbon monoxide poisoning, which can cause signs that are often puzzled with tiredness. It can be deadly in severe cases.
Gas safety record
Landlords have a legal duty to guarantee that their gas devices are safe for renters to use. They need to get a Gas Safety Certificate, also referred to as a CP12, for each appliance in the property every year. This is a requirement of the law and failure to abide by it can lead to significant fines.
A CP12 is a file that consists of details of the inspection and checks carried out by a Gas Safe signed up engineer. It will consist of the date of the check and a list of all devices consisted of in the examination. It will also include the engineer's name and registration number. It is necessary that the landlord indications this file, and they need to likewise give a copy to the tenant within 28 days of the check.
It is essential that the landlord keeps a record of all assessments and CP12's issued for each annual gas safety check Buckingham device in their residential or commercial property. This will assist them monitor when every one expires, and they can make sure they schedule their yearly gas assessment before the date of the present certificate passes.
When a CP12 is provided, it must be provided to the occupant and maintained by the landlord for 2 years. The landlord should likewise offer a copy of the CP12 to all brand-new tenants before they relocate, and it needs to be available for them to see at any time throughout their tenancy.
In addition to the Gas Safety Certificate, it is likewise necessary to have all gas devices serviced regularly by a certified Gas Safe engineer. This will assist to lower the danger of carbon monoxide poisoning, which can kill a person in simply a few hours. This is specifically important if the renter has kids or senior individuals living in the residential or commercial property.
It is necessary to keep in mind that a Gas Safety Certificate does not consist of a boiler service, Gas Safety Engineers Buckingham so it is suggested that the boiler is also serviced at the very same time as the safety check. Having regular checks done will help to avoid any prospective concerns and conserve the landlord cash in the long run.

Unlike gas boilers, electrical boilers do not produce carbon monoxide and can be set up in a variety of areas. They are likewise simple to preserve and can be used if you have no mains gas supply. Furthermore, they can be less expensive to run than gas boilers in areas with high energy costs.
However, electric boilers can not offer as much warm water as gas boilers and they need to be connected to a warm water cylinder. This can make them less appropriate for larger homes and facilities with higher hot water demands. Nevertheless, they can still be an excellent choice for smaller residential or commercial properties in the UK, where space is a premium.

Landlords need to give their occupants written notice before going into a home for upkeep or gas safety checks. If the tenant refuses to permit gain access to, then the landlord needs to reveal that they have taken all 'affordable actions' to comply with the law. This consists of repeating their request and composing to the renter to discuss why the gain access to is required.
